Solución al error could not load requested class com mysql jdbc driver

Al intentar conectarse a una base de datos MySQL desde Java, puede ocurrir el error «could not load requested class com mysql jdbc driver». Este error indica que Java no puede encontrar la clase del controlador JDBC de MySQL que es necesaria para conectarse a la base de datos. Este problema puede ser frustrante y difícil de solucionar, pero existen varias soluciones posibles que se pueden probar para resolverlo. En este artículo, revisaremos algunas de las soluciones más comunes para este error y cómo puedes implementarlas en tu código Java.

Aprende a solucionar el error Class forName com.mysql.jdbc.Driver en tus proyectos Java

Si te has encontrado con el error Class forName com.mysql.jdbc.Driver en tus proyectos Java, no te preocupes, es un problema común y tiene solución.

Este error se debe a que Java no puede encontrar el controlador de la base de datos MySQL que estás utilizando. Esto sucede porque no has incluido la librería correspondiente en tu aplicación.

Para solucionarlo, primero debes asegurarte de que tienes la librería mysql-connector-java.jar y de que la has agregado correctamente a tu proyecto en el classpath. Puedes hacerlo de varias maneras, dependiendo de la herramienta de construcción que estés utilizando (Maven, Gradle, etc.).

Luego debes asegurarte de que estás incluyendo la línea de código correcta para cargar el controlador de la base de datos en tu aplicación:

¿Cómo solucionar el error could not start the service mysql?¿Cómo solucionar el error could not start the service mysql?

Class.forName(«com.mysql.jdbc.Driver»);

si estás utilizando una versión más reciente de MySQL, puede que debas utilizar la clase com.mysql.cj.jdbc.Driver en su lugar.

Si aún así sigues teniendo problemas, puede que sea necesario revisar tu configuración de la base de datos y asegurarte de que todo está correctamente configurado.

En resumen, el error Class forName com.mysql.jdbc.Driver es un problema común en proyectos Java que utilizan MySQL como base de datos. Afortunadamente, tiene solución y generalmente se debe a una falta de configuración o a la omisión de una librería.

¿Has encontrado algún otro error común al trabajar con Java y bases de datos? Comparte tu experiencia en la sección de comentarios y ayudemos a otros desarrolladores a solucionar problemas similares.

Solución al error Class not found exception com mysql jdbc driver al conectar con bases de datos MySQL

Ejecutar MySQL desde consola: Guía básica y paso a pasoCrear base de datos MySQL en Consola Windows: Guía paso a paso

Si estás trabajando con bases de datos MySQL y te aparece el error «Class not found exception com mysql jdbc driver» al intentar conectar con la base de datos desde tu código Java, no te preocupes, ¡hay solución!

Este error se produce porque el driver de MySQL no se encuentra en el classpath de tu aplicación. Para solucionarlo, necesitas descargar el driver de MySQL y añadirlo al classpath.

Para descargar el driver, entra en la página de descargas de MySQL e indica la versión de tu base de datos MySQL. Una vez descargado el archivo .jar, añade la ruta del archivo a tu classpath. En NetBeans, por ejemplo, puedes hacerlo en la pestaña «Libraries» del proyecto.

Ahora ya deberías poder conectar con tu base de datos MySQL desde tu código Java sin problemas.

Recuerda:

  • Descarga el driver de MySQL correspondiente a la versión de tu base de datos.
  • Añade la ruta del archivo .jar del driver al classpath de tu aplicación.

Es importante asegurarse de tener el driver correcto para evitar problemas de conexión. Con estos simples pasos, podrás solventar el error «Class not found exception com mysql jdbc driver» y seguir trabajando con tu base de datos MySQL desde tu código Java.

Guía para crear secuencia en MySQLGuía para crear secuencia en MySQL

La conexión con bases de datos es un aspecto fundamental en el desarrollo de aplicaciones, y es importante estar preparados para encontrar y solucionar errores con rapidez y eficacia. ¡Sigue aprendiendo para mejorar tu experiencia como programador!

Solucionando el error java.lang.classnotfoundexception com.mysql.cj.jdbc.driver en NetBeans

Si eres un desarrollador en NetBeans que está intentando conectar una base de datos MySQL mediante el uso del conector MySQL JDBC, es posible que te hayas encontrado con un error común: java.lang.classnotfoundexception com.mysql.cj.jdbc.driver. Este error surge cuando NetBeans no puede encontrar el controlador necesario para conectarse a la base de datos MySQL.

La solución a este problema es bastante sencilla. Todo lo que necesitas hacer es agregar la librería del conector MySQL JDBC a tu proyecto de NetBeans.

Para ello, sigue estos sencillos pasos:

  1. Descarga el archivo del conector MySQL JDBC desde la página oficial de descargas de MySQL.
  2. Descomprime el archivo descargado y copia el archivo JAR en una ubicación de tu elección en tu disco duro.
  3. En NetBeans, abre tu proyecto y haz clic con el botón derecho del ratón en la carpeta “Bibliotecas”.
  4. Selecciona “Agregar biblioteca…” y da a la biblioteca un nombre descriptivo, como “Conector MySQL JDBC”.
  5. Selecciona la biblioteca que acabas de crear y haz clic en el botón “Añadir archivo JAR”.
  6. Navega a la ubicación donde guardaste el archivo JAR del conector MySQL JDBC y selecciónalo.
  7. Ahora, cuando intentes conectarte a tu base de datos MySQL desde NetBeans, ya no deberías recibir el error “java.lang.classnotfoundexception com.mysql.cj.jdbc.driver”.

En resumen, solucionar el error java.lang.classnotfoundexception com.mysql.cj.jdbc.driver en NetBeans es fácil y rápido. Simplemente necesitas agregar la librería del conector MySQL JDBC a tu proyecto y el error desaparecerá.

Es importante siempre recordar actualizar las librerías y versiones de los conectores a medida que vayan actualizando, lo que nos permitirá trabajar de manera más eficiente y efectiva.

Esperamos que este artículo haya sido de gran ayuda para solucionar el error «could not load requested class com mysql jdbc driver». Recuerda que siempre es importante estar actualizado y verificar la compatibilidad de las versiones de los diferentes componentes de tu proyecto. Si tienes alguna duda o sugerencia, ¡no dudes en hacérnosla saber!

¡Hasta la próxima!

Si quieres conocer otros artículos parecidos a Solución al error could not load requested class com mysql jdbc driver puedes visitar la categoría Informática.

Ivan

Soy un entusiasta de la tecnología con especialización en bases de datos, particularmente en MySQL. A través de mis tutoriales detallados, busco desmitificar los conceptos complejos y proporcionar soluciones prácticas a los desafíos cotidianos relacionados con la gestión de datos

Aprende mas sobre MySQL

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ir